SSR Mining (NASDAQ:SSRM) revealed Sunday that Turkey’s government has rescinded the Copler gold mine’s environmental permit, leaving the mine suspended until further notice. This response follows a recent landslide that resulted in nine workers being reported missing.

The company disclosed that several staff members are now grappling with charges stemming from the incident. Turkey’s Interior Minister cited a dislodgement of 10M cubic meters of earth across a 200-meter slope.

While the Turkish Ministry of the Environment’s tests of the region’s surface water, groundwater, and soil showed no contamination, SSR Mining (SSRM) had projected about 220,000 ounces of gold production at Copler this year – roughly half of the company’s expected global output. SSR Mining holds an 80% interest in the mine.
